What is Disclosure Statement

The Professional Disclosure Statement is a healthcare document used by clients to understand their counselor's background, policies, and fees before entering therapy.

What is the Professional Disclosure Statement?

The Professional Disclosure Statement is an essential document in the therapeutic process, designed to inform clients about the counselor's qualifications and therapeutic approach. It plays a pivotal role by ensuring clients are aware of the counselor's background, thus fostering trust and transparency. By providing comprehensive information, the professional disclosure statement enhances the therapeutic relationship from the outset.
This statement outlines the counselor’s qualifications, methodologies, and policies, equipping clients with the knowledge they need before beginning therapy. The clarity offered by this document is crucial in establishing a comfortable and informed environment for therapy to take place.

Purpose and Benefits of the Professional Disclosure Statement

Clients receive the Professional Disclosure Statement before counseling begins to ensure they understand the therapeutic landscape. This document provides significant benefits, including:
  • Clarifying confidentiality policies to protect client privacy.
  • Outlining counseling fees to promote transparency in financial aspects.
  • Defining the boundaries and expectations through a counseling consent form.
Understanding these components is vital for clients to engage confidently in the therapy process, contributing to a more productive experience overall.

Key Features of the Professional Disclosure Statement

The Professional Disclosure Statement includes essential components that lay the groundwork for therapy. Key features typically found in this document are:
  • Confidentiality policies that explain client information handling.
  • Detailed fee structures that outline the costs associated with therapy.
  • Emergency contact procedures for immediate assistance.
Additionally, both client and counselor signatures are required to indicate mutual understanding and agreement, reinforcing the significance of the counseling agreement.

Who Needs the Professional Disclosure Statement?

The Professional Disclosure Statement primarily benefits clients preparing to engage in therapy. It is crucial for both clients and counselors to complete and sign this form, ensuring mutual recognition of the counseling framework. Individuals experiencing mental health challenges will find this statement particularly useful, as it clarifies their rights and expectations during treatment.

Both the client and the counselor must sign the Professional Disclosure Statement. This ensures mutual understanding and agreement to the counseling process and terms.
No, notarization is not required for the Professional Disclosure Statement. The signatures from both the client and counselor are sufficient for the form's validity.
The confidentiality section should outline how the counselor will handle personal information, the limits of confidentiality, and circumstances under which information may be disclosed.
Yes, the Professional Disclosure Statement is typically completed before or at the first counseling session to establish guidelines and expectations between the client and counselor.
Failure to sign may prevent the commencement of counseling services as the form indicates your consent and acknowledgment of the counselor's policies and practices.
There is no strict deadline for submission, but it is recommended to complete and return the form before your first counseling appointment to ensure a smooth process.
